Output 8d3985151d1f2129d6fbf27e79d27c8fed1229dbf8c43eb1d5000a4e32ea5e65:0

value
71311026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57084cd682a98eb58d8ef7c50ed28e12c1b67c6f OP_EQUAL
address
MFqLxpjeehwiVRzbPM2Kd5yBbCFGpAB65Q
transaction
8d3985151d1f2129d6fbf27e79d27c8fed1229dbf8c43eb1d5000a4e32ea5e65
spent
true